Model subtraction of fraction:
cricket20 [7]
The entire race is 1 full race.
One full race is 1.
He ran 3/8 of 1, so he ran 3/8.
He needs to run the rest of the race.
The rest is unknown, so we call it x.
When you add 3/8 to the unknown, you get the full race.
The equation is

x + 3/8 = 1

Change 1 to a denominator of 8.

x + 3/8 = 8/8

Subtract 3/8 from both sides.

x = 5/8

Answer: He still needs to run 5/8 of the race.

A circular trampoline has a radius of 8 feet. Wendy wants to buy a cover for the trampoline. What will be the area of the cover
padilas [110]

Answer:

Option (3)

Step-by-step explanation:

Area of a circle is given by the formula,

Area = πr²

Here, r = radius of the circle

Since, radius of the circular trampoline = 8 feet

Area of the cover required for the circular trampoline = π(8)²

                                                                                         = 64π square feet

Therefore, Option (3) will be the answer.
